I'm not too sure about Guitar Hero....I mean, it looks fun and all, but I'd rather spend my time getting better at the real guitar. The bad thing is I think many people will go for Guitar Hero as its much easier than learning the real guitar (A conversation with one of my friends was a good case in point, where he said that he played Guitar Hero because he couldn't be bothered to learn the real one). Hopefully to alot of people this will be a sort of a gateway thing where they play Guitar Hero and move on to the learn the real guitar....but I can't help but think this isn't true....

What do you guys think?

Most people play Guitar Hero because it provides them with more entertainment than playing the actual guitar. Not everyone is willing to spend years mastering an instrument when they can jam to their favourite tunes with none. It's not a question of laziness either, instruments aren't all made to be fun and games. Learning to pluck strings isn't as entertaining as playing a videogame or some people. Why do i play Guitar Hero and not the actual instrument? Well, i just find it to be more fun, nothing more.

Actually there is one way it helps and that is to get you used to moving your fingers, especially the pinky. I have been playing GH for about a year now and I play expert quite well. I can move my fingers much faster and easier now thanks to the game.

My being able to play GH as well as I do has made me decide to start actually trying to learn real guitar. Unfortunately I am short on time and money so I am self-teaching. Currently learning my first song, Seven Nation Army by White Stripes. Definitely easier I think with the GH experience especially the hammer on/ pull off part of the chorus which I got right first try, something I owe thanks to GH for.
